Cucumber SaladCold cucumber salad is a simple home-style dish made primarily from cucumbers. After slicing, the cucumbers are mixed with seasonings to create a refreshing and crisp dish. The dish features a bright green color and a refreshing, crunchy texture, making it a popular appetizer in summer.
Free-range ChickenFree-range local chicken, slaughtered and prepared by stewing, boiling, or braising. Main ingredient is chicken, seasoned with ginger and scallions, optionally with dried mushrooms and goji berries to preserve the original flavor.
Baby bok choyBaby bok choy is a small type of Chinese cabbage with a fresh and tender texture. Common cooking methods include stir-frying, garlic stir-fry, or simmering in clear soup. To prepare, first wash the baby bok choy thoroughly, then add appropriate seasonings and ingredients according to your chosen method, and stir-fry until soft or simmer until flavorful.

Frog LegsFrogs legs, known for their tender texture and delicious flavor, are the main ingredient in this dish. Typically stir-fried with chili peppers, scallions, ginger, and garlic, the frogs' legs are carefully cooked to achieve a tender and richly flavored result—making it a nutritious and delightful delicacy.

Lotus Pond Softshell TurtleLotus pond turtle is a dish featuring turtle as the main ingredient, paired with lotus root, water chestnuts, snap peas, and wood ear mushrooms. The turtle is blanched first, then stewed or braised with vegetables to blend flavors. The broth is rich, and the ingredients are tender and delicious.
